Let's say I've generated a chart with the following code:

private ChartPanel createChart(){
        XYSeries series1 = new XYSeries("First");
        XYSeries series2 = new XYSeries("Second");
        XYSeries series3 = new XYSeries("Third");

        series1.add(0.0, 5.5);
        series1.add(5, 10);
        series1.add(10, 5.5);

        series2.add(0.0, 2);
        series2.add(5, 2);
        series2.add(10, 7);

        series3.add(0.0, 10);
        series3.add(5, 5);
        series3.add(10, 6);

        XYSeriesCollection dataset = new XYSeriesCollection();

        dataset.addSeries(series1);
        dataset.addSeries(series2);
        dataset.addSeries(series3);

        JFreeChart chart = ChartFactory.createXYLineChart("line chart example",
                "X", "Y", dataset, PlotOrientation.VERTICAL, true, true, false);
        ChartPanel chartPanel = new ChartPanel(chart);
        chartPanel.setPreferredSize(new java.awt.Dimension(500, 270));
        return chartPanel;
    }

Now I would like to modify a value previously inserted in an XYSeries without build another chart (no other call to createXYLineChart), and make the chart automatically updated.

How do this?

Just look at the api.

There are many different methods, depending if you know the index of the element in the series, or if you know the x-value, but want to change the y-value. I assume the chart will be redrawn since all the methods throw a SeriesChangeEvent.

  • `update`, `updateByIndex`, `addOrUpdate`. Actually, it looks like that if you want to change the x-coordinate, you'll have to erase the point first with `remove`; `remove` can take the x-value or the index of the point in the series. – toto2 Aug 23 '11 at 17:30
